#3fc54e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3fc54e is composed of 24.7% red, 77.3%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.4%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 126.7 degrees, a saturation of 53.6% and a lightness of 51%. #3fc54e color hex could be obtained by blending #7eff9c with #008b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

● #3fc54e color description : Moderate lime green.
#3fc54e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3fc54e has RGB values of R:63, G:197,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 4179278.
